Job Description

We are seeking a highly skilled DevOps professional with strong expertise in cloud environments, automation, monitoring and platform reliability. This role focuses on supporting Vodafone services through robust DevOps practices, ensuring high availability, performance, and scalability. The individual will work across infrastructure and application layers, handling incident management, proactive monitoring, and continuous improvement within a 24/7 operational model.
